Can citizens die on their own in Vampyr? Vampyr Guide and Walkthrough

In Vampyr, you can find a lot of citizens who are prone to become sick and fall ill to a disease. This chapter will answer the question – do the inhabitants die by themselves with the elapse of time?

NPC sickness and cure

  • Sick residents do not die, but their state of health has a negative impact on the overall health of the district.
  • If you do not treat the residents, you can quickly bring a situation in which the health of the district falls below serious level. That's just a step away from the critical state of the district.
  • If the condition of a district falls below critical, the district will collapse. The people will die and enemies will appear in the region, which have been friendly so far.
  • It is therefore worth treating the sick on an ongoing basis and ensuring that the health condition of the district is maintained at a high level. Probably you are planning to play a "bad character" - then you can aim to exterminate the inhabitants as much as you can. You will then be able to gain access to many closed chests and private goods of various characters.
